How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Burlington?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Burlington Studio Apartments Under $2000 | $917 | $795 | $1,025 |
| Burlington 1 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,271 | $625 | $1,645 |
| Burlington 2 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,430 | $755 | $1,850 |
| Burlington 3 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,694 | $795 | $2,360 |
| Burlington 4 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,354 | $775 | $2,720 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Burlington
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Burlington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Burlington ranges from $625 to $1,645 with an average monthly rent of $1,271.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Burlington c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Burlington range from $755 to $1,850.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,430.
How expensive are Burlington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 61 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Burlington on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$795 to $2,360 - averaging $1,694 for the location.
